Water Resource Engineer: This role involves designing and implementing water resource systems, such as dams, reservoirs, and irrigation systems. Water Resource Engineers often work in consulting firms, government agencies, or utility companies. Water Conservation Specialist: Water Conservation Specialists focus on promoting efficient water use and reducing water waste. They may work in a variety of settings, including government agencies, non-profit organizations, and private companies. Hydrologist: Hydrologists study the properties and movement of water, including its distribution and circulation. They often work in environmental consulting or government agencies, conducting research and analysis to inform water resource planning and management. Environmental Scientist: Environmental Scientists conduct research and analyze data to understand and address environmental problems. They may work in government agencies, consulting firms, or non-profit organizations. GIS Specialist: GIS Specialists use geographic information systems (GIS) technology to analyze and visualize spatial data. They may work in a variety of industries, including environmental consulting, government agencies, and utility companies.
